Sure if you like. This whole thing could do with a bit of TLC though.

I actually did a load more reverse engineering work a few years back which I never got around to writing up. I've got another server that can talk directly to a Texecom panel using the Wintex protocol, which I clean-room reverse engineered. With this you can implement stuff like a fully functional remote keypad via MQTT, and you can get a real-time live stream of all the zone statuses. I was already looking at using Docker for that, if I ever find the time to get back to it.
